WordPress主题srcset设置
时间 : 2024-04-07 03:34: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案
在 WordPress 主题中,`srcset` 是用于响应式图像展示的一种 HTML 属性,能够让浏览器根据不同的屏幕尺寸选择合适的图像资源加载。通过为 `srcset` 属性指定不同分辨率的图片路径,浏览器可以根据设备的屏幕分辨率和像素密度选择合适的图片进行显示,从而提高页面加载速度和用户体验。
要在 WordPress 主题中使用 `srcset` 属性,首先需要确保在主题中调用图片的函数中添加相应的参数,以便生成带有 `srcset` 属性的图片标签。在 WordPress 中,可以使用 `wp_get_attachment_image()` 函数来获取附加到指定帖子的图像,并包含 `srcset` 属性。添加 `srcset` 的参数可以指定不同大小的图片和分辨率,如以下示例所示:
```php
$image_size = 'large'; // 图片尺寸
$image_id = get_post_thumbnail_id(); // 获取图像 ID
$image_srcset = wp_get_attachment_image_srcset($image_id, $image_size); // 获取带有 srcset 属性的图像标签
$image = wp_get_attachment_image($image_id, $image_size, false, array('srcset' => $image_srcset)); // 生成带有 srcset 属性的图片标签
echo $image; // 输出带有 srcset 属性的图片
确保在调用图片的地方使用正确的图像尺寸和参数来生成带有 `srcset` 属性的图片标签,这样就能让浏览器根据不同的屏幕尺寸加载适合的图片资源,提升网站的性能和用户体验。
其他答案
WordPress主题中的`srcset`设置是用于响应式图片的一种技术,它允许网站根据用户设备的屏幕大小和分辨率动态调整图片的尺寸和像素密度,从而提高页面加载速度和用户体验。在WordPress中,`srcset`设置通常是通过在主题中使用`<img>`标签的`srcset`属性来实现的。以下是设置`srcset`的一般步骤:
1. 在主题的模板文件中找到输出图片的地方,通常是在`single.php`、`page.php`或`header.php`等文件中。
2. 在`<img>`标签中添加`srcset`属性,格式如下:
在上面的示例中,`srcset`属性定义了不同屏幕宽度下展示的图片尺寸和像素密度,每个图像都有一个宽度描述符(例如`400w`表示400像素宽度)。`sizes`属性定义了不同屏幕尺寸下图片展示的大小。
3. 确保为每个图片提供不同尺寸和像素密度的图片文件,并根据实际需求进行调整和优化。
通过设置`srcset`属性,WordPress主题可以更好地适应不同设备的屏幕,为用户提供更好的图片展示和加载体验。这样不仅可以提高页面加载速度,还可以节省带宽和减少数据传输成本。
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章